返回顶部
当前位置:首页 > 资讯 > 比特币交易公钥签名

比特币交易公钥签名

时间:2023-08-31 11:59:43

小编:小编

阅读:

比特币交易公钥签名是比特币交易中的一项重要技术,通过使用比特币公钥,使得交易的安全性得到了保障。比特币公钥可以在比特币网络中找到。

比特币交易公钥签名

首先,我们需要了解比特币交易的基本原理。比特币是一种基于区块链技术的数字货币,其交易记录被记录在一个公开的分布式账本中,这就是所谓的区块链。在比特币交易中,参与交易的用户需要使用私钥对交易进行签名,以确保交易的真实性和完整性。而比特币交易公钥就是用来验证交易签名的。

比特币公钥是从比特币私钥派生出来的,其生成是通过椭圆曲线加密算法实现的。比特币私钥是一个由随机数生成的256位数字,而比特币公钥则是由私钥通过特定的算法计算得到的。比特币公钥是一个长字符串,通常以04开头,其长度为130个字符。具体的生成过程是私钥通过椭圆曲线乘法运算与基点相乘得到公钥。

一旦比特币公钥生成,它就可以被用来创建比特币交易地址。比特币交易地址是一个由公钥通过哈希算法生成的字符串,用来接收比特币。比特币交易地址通常以1或3开头,其长度为34个字符。比特币交易地址可以通过比特币网络进行查询,以检查余额和交易历史。

在比特币交易中,交易双方需要使用各自的私钥对交易进行签名。签名过程使用的是椭圆曲线数字签名算法(ECDSA),它使用私钥对交易进行加密,并生成一个数字签名。而交易的接收方可以使用发送方的公钥和数字签名来验证交易的真实性。

比特币交易公钥签名的目的是确保交易的真实性和完整性。当一个交易被创建后,发送方将使用私钥对交易进行签名,并将签名与交易一起发送给比特币网络。其他节点在接收到交易后,会使用发送方的公钥和数字签名来验证交易的有效性。如果验证成功,交易将被添加到区块链上,完成交易过程。

比特币交易公钥签名的设计使得比特币网络具备了高度的安全性。私钥只有交易的发送方拥有,而公钥和数字签名可以被任何人验证。这意味着即使交易的详细信息被公开,其他人也无法伪造交易或篡改交易的内容。这种设计减少了交易的风险,保护了比特币网络的安全。

在比特币交易中,公钥和私钥是密切相关的,它们共同构成了比特币的安全机制。通过使用比特币公钥来验证交易签名,比特币网络实现了去中心化的安全性。这种安全性不仅适用于比特币交易,还可以应用于其他基于区块链技术的数字货币和交易系统中。

总之,比特币交易公钥签名是比特币交易安全性的关键所在。比特币公钥可以通过比特币网络查询获得,它是通过私钥通过椭圆曲线加密算法生成的。比特币交易公钥签名的设计使得交易的真实性和完整性得到了保障,保护了比特币网络的安全。比特币交易公钥签名的原理和应用将会在未来的数字货币交易中扮演重要的角色。

上一篇:比特币第一交易所app

下一篇:最后一页